This week's top dish from Eater Chicago, Curbed's restaurant, bar, and nightlife blog...
GOLD COAST—Returning to Chicago, but not to the court, Michael Jordan's Steak House opened inside the InterContinental hotel this week.
FULTON MARKET—Moto chef/owner Homoro Cantu shuttered his molecular gastronomic spot last week, but just for a bit. He's completely overhauling the kitchen and will reopen the restaurant on Sept. 1 as Moto 4.0.
WEST TOWN—Eater talks to intimate BYO spot Ruxbin, which was named No. 5 best new restaurant in the U.S. by Bon Appetit, about its first year in business.
LOGAN SQUARE—Answering the call to feed more diners, Bonsoiree is gearing up to open a glass-enclosed backyard patio with a retractable roof.
